The Mountain View School District board voted to set its required budget hearing for June 17 during the regular June meeting.
Staff member (S3) told trustees that the hearing is mandated by statute as part of the deconsolidation process and recommended holding it at the June board meeting. “We are legally required to have a budget hearing where we go over our budget for the year,” S3 said, noting the board must also meet separate audit reporting requirements before the district completes deconsolidation. Committee member (S2) moved to set the hearing for 06/17/2026; the motion was seconded and approved by the board.
The board will hold the hearing as a public meeting and expects to present the proposed budget and take public comment before any final adoption. Auditors’ reports and any statutory filings tied to the deconsolidation will be scheduled separately as required.
